Neighborhoods

Greenehaven is a quiet neighborhood about 12 miles north of Page, close to the Utah/Arizona border and within 5-10 distance to Lone Rock Beach and Lake Powell Resorts marina. A perfect neighborhood to walk around in the morning and late afternoon, you will see bunnies on the road and the spectacular Grand Staircase Escalante National Monument from afar. A gas station is in the neighborhood, with a 24-hour minimart. They have everything you need during your stay.

Sightseeing

Beautiful viewpoint to see a horseshoe-shaped meander on the Colorado River. Come in the early morning before the other visitors arrive, or wait until later in the afternoon so you can view the sunset. Parking is $5 per car.

Antelope Canyon

Antelope Canyon represents the power of wind and water. There are Upper Antelope Canyon and Lower Antelope Canyon, and you need to arrange the visit in advance (sometimes months in advance) due to the limited number of people allowed into the canyons. A Navajo guide must accompany your group at all times. Upper Antelope Canyon is the most popular, a walk-on canyon that is easy for children and the elderly alike. Lower Antelope Canyon has steps down and up but has wider passages.

Adventure abounds!

I would recommend these things to pack: - Sunscreen: even during winter, the sun can be quite unforgiving. - Light jacket (summer) and thick jacket (winter): Wind can come at any time during the summer, and you can see 30 degrees Fahrenheit during the winter.
